In order to ensure the stability of the beach and coast, three times of shoreface nourishments(1998, 2002 and 2006) have been launched in the Noordwijk, the Netherlands. There are double subtidal bars developed in the study area. For three times, sands are nourished on the seaward side of the outer bar, which is close to the local closure depth. The shoreface nourishment reduced seaward migration rates of the bar. Both the inner and outer bars show a trend of onshore migration and remain stable,which has a positive effect on the shoreline stability. Facts prove that shoreface nourishment may resist against coastal erosion and keep the beach stable by increasing wave dissipation and keeping the nourished sands moving onshore. At present, most of the beach protection projects in China are dominated by beach nourishment, which are economically expensive, environmentally destructive and ineffective, while the shoreface nourishment has the advantages of economy, small impact on the environment and flexibility. We should make full use of the successful experience of shoreface nourishment. In this paper the effects of shoreface nourishments of Noordwijk is studied and analyzed based on Argus video images and bathymetric data. And the significance of shoreface nourishment is summarized to enrich and promote the development of coastal management.
